Does anybody know if there is aftermarket front spring insulators out there for the 1g? Long story short I threw all of my old stock stuff away not remembering I needed the insulator. I have looked for quite a while and have come up with nothing!
 
I didn't see anything on rockauto.com listed for a 1g. The factory part number is, MB518149.
 
Is this the part between the pad and the strut mount? The part number for that part is, MB518147, and the strut mount is, MB518141
